Предотвращение создания пустых слоёв для ogr2ogr

Ответить
Аватара пользователя
Denis Rykov
Гуру
Сообщения: 3376
Зарегистрирован: 11 апр 2008, 21:09
Репутация: 529
Ваше звание: Author
Контактная информация:

Предотвращение создания пустых слоёв для ogr2ogr

Сообщение Denis Rykov » 29 май 2014, 08:59

Можно как-то сделать так, чтобы при создании слоёв с помощью ogr2ogr слой не создавался, если в нём нет объектов. Пример:

Код: Выделить всё

ogr2ogr -where "OGR_GEOMETRY='Polygon'" -lco "ENCODING=CP1251" -overwrite target source.sxf
В данном случае SXF будет разбит на слои согласно классификатору, но потом после наложения фильтра по типу геометрии слой может оказаться пустым.
Spatial is now, more than ever, just another column- The Geometry Column.

Аватара пользователя
Максим Дубинин
MindingMyOwnBusiness
Сообщения: 9128
Зарегистрирован: 06 окт 2003, 20:20
Репутация: 747
Ваше звание: NextGIS
Откуда: Москва
Контактная информация:

Re: Предотвращение создания пустых слоёв для ogr2ogr

Сообщение Максим Дубинин » 29 май 2014, 10:11

проще потом дать команду чтобы удалить пустые слои, например по размеру
пристегивайтесь, турбулентность прямо по курсу

Ответить

Вернуться в «GDAL/OGR»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 0 гостей